previous post
Road to E3 2011 – Sonic Generations
next post
LEGO Star Wars 3: The Clone Wars Guide
by Anthony Gerhart
Ah, the LEGO franchise. Well-known for its slapstick humor, the accessible puzzles, and its innovative co-op mechanics. TT Games is at it again with their third Star Wars installment, and this time, the…